Amanda Holden
Amanda Louise Holden (born 16 February 1971) is an English media personality, actress, television presenter, singer, and author. She has judged on the television talent show competition Britain's Got Talent since the show began its run in 2007 on ITV. As an actress, Holden played the role of Mel in Kiss Me Kate (1998–2000), Geraldine Titley in The Grimleys (1999-2001), Sarah Trevanion in Wild at Heart (2006–2008), Lizzie, the Ring Mistress, in Big Top (2009), and the title role in Thoroughly Modern Millie, for which she was nominated for a Laurence Olivier Award.

UCLA-Michgan State NCAA Tournament First Four Game Sets Ratings Mark

UCLA’s overtime victory over Michigan State in a battle of marquee programs averaged 3 million viewers Thursday night on TBS, the best viewership for an NCAA Tournament First Four play-in game since the format was introduced in 2011, according to Nielsen.Overall, the First Four games to kick off the 2021 NCAA men’s basketball tournament were watched by 7.6 million viewers across TBS, truTV, NCAA March Madness Live and TV Everywhere platforms.
